Nairobi Governor Johnson Sakaja has directed all building owners in the Nairobi Central Business District (CBD) to repaint their buildings within the next 90 days.
Speaking on Sunday, January 19, Governor Sakaja announced that a circular outlining the specifics of the directive will be issued soon. However, he did not indicate whether the buildings would need to adhere to a specific color scheme.
“To everyone who has a building in the Nairobi Central Business District (CBD), we are issuing a circular tomorrow directing that all those buildings must be repainted within 90 days. In this period, we will also work on restoring roads within Nairobi,” Sakaja stated.
This initiative aims to give the CBD a fresh look, complementing broader efforts to enhance the city’s infrastructure.
The directive echoes a similar move made in Mombasa County in 2018, where landlords were ordered to uniformly paint all buildings.
